- Charging port issues?
Is your phone being charged slowly, or are you facing any charging port issues? If yes, then the main felon might be your faulty charging port. When your phone experiences slow or no charging, often the prime culprit is a faulty charging port. When this problem occurs, the chances are that the small metal connector might be connecting to the USB port properly. There are several reasons for it, like dust or debris blocked due to the contact that prevents the proper power supply to the device, or if you live in a humid environment, your cell phone might be corrupted.
There can be any reason for it, and even if you know the cause, you should not try to fix it by yourself as you can end up damaging it more, and that is something that you obviously do not want. Taking it to your service repair centre is the best option that you got.
- Water Damage:
Accidentally slipped your phone in the swimming pool or spilled coffee on it? Whatever the reason, damaging your phone with water is annoying and comes with irreversible problems to the phone. You can follow some of the tricks like removing all the liquid from your phone almost immediately, splitting up the components like SIM Card, SD Card, and even putting it in rice can help in reducing the extent of the damage.
